‘New Topographics’ Palma

‘New Topographics’ was a movement fuelled by the shift in landscape photography. During the acceleration of urban development, photographers began to turn their lenses to stark, industrial landscapes and suburbia, far from the traditional, romanticised views we first think of when the term ‘landscape’ is mentioned. In this shoot, I explore Palma de Mallorca in an attempt to unify rural and urban concepts by illustrating how nature is incorporated into our modern cityscapes, whilst referencing some of the artists’ work who were involved in the New Topographics movement.
